Case Study 2 : Trade Discount
An owner of a pet shop received an invoice for the purchase of 200 bottles of shower gel at
RM15 each. He was offered trade discount of 10% and 6% .

a) Calculate the net price of 200 bottles of shower gel.

FORMULA : NP= LP (1-d1)(1-d2)

LP = 15 d = 10 and 6 = 0.1 and 0.06

NP= 15 (1-0.1)(0.06)

= 12.69

=12.69 multiply 200 = RM 2538


b) Find the total amount of discount of entire purchase .

FORMULA = D= LP x d

=200 x 15 = RM 3000

D = 3000 – 2538

D = RM 462
C) Find the list price of a shower gel if the price after 10% and 6% discount is
RM 12

NP = LP (1 – D1) (1 – D2)

12 = LP ( 1 – 0.1 ) (1 – 0.06)

12 = LP (0.846)

12/0.846 = LP

LP = RM 14.18
d) suppose that trade discount x% is given. Find the value of x if the net price
of a shower gel after x% is RM 14.40
TRADE DISCOUNT = x%
NP = 14.40
14.40 + 15 ( 1 – x )
14.40 = 15- 15x
15x = 15-14.40
15x = 0.6
X = 0.6/15
X = 0.04 , d = 0.04
= 4%
